AI Generated Summary

This bill, introduced in the Minnesota Senate (S.F. No. 2292) by Senators Hawj and Oumou Verbeten, appropriates funds for workforce development. Specifically, it allocates $400,000 in fiscal years 2025 and 2026 from the general fund to the commissioner of employment and economic development for a grant to 30000 Feet, a nonprofit organization. The grant will support youth apprenticeship jobs, wraparound services, afterschool programming, and summer learning loss prevention efforts targeted at African American youth.
